The Role
As a Principal Engineer (EUC), you will be a senior technical leader responsible for setting the engineering direction across multiple technologies, ensuring the delivery of robust, scalable and secure digital solutions combining deep technical expertise with strategical thinking.
Day-to-day, you’ll work with architecture, assisting with defining the technical strategy architecture for both complex systems and platforms providing hands-on technical leadership across multiple teams.
Your responsibilities will include:
- Acting as a trusted advisor to senior stakeholders, translating business needs into technical solutions
- Providing hands-on technical leadership
- Collaborate with product owners or capability leads and other disciplines to ensure cohesive delivery
- Providing expert-level knowledge in end user computing
- Leading and making technical decisions whilst resolving complex engineering challenges
- Overseeing large-scale device lifecycle operations and governing enterprise-wide device strategy
Essential experience of the Principal Engineer (EUC):
- Deep expertise in architecting and scaling VDI solutions using Citrix Virtual Apps & Desktops, VMware Horizon and Azure Virtual Desktop
- Previous experience overseeing application virtualisation strategies using technologies such as Microsoft App-V, Citrix App Layering and MSIX
- The ability to lead in endpoint identity and access management
- Previous experience leading automation initiatives for software packaging, telemetry-driven remediation and policy enforcement
- Deep understanding of endpoint security controls
- Proven experience in strategic Leadership
Essential qualifications for the Principal Engineer (EUC):
- A degree in Computer Science, Engineering or a related field or equivalent experience
